On Thursday, October 30, in the late evening, Kevin went to the Des Moines, Iowa hospital with chest pain.  After several tests in the ER, Kevin was diagnosed with an aortic dissection that required immediate surgery.

Kevin spent the next 9 hours in surgery to repair his aorta and replace his aortic valve.  The surgery was successful and he was recovering.  However, the following week, Kevin was having weakness on one side of his body, and it was determined he was having a possible stroke. Kevin was taken to the Cath lab emergently. As Kevin was in too much pain to lay on his back during the catheterization, he was sedated and intubated. Kevin still remains on the ventilator to this day.  He still has a long road to his recovery.
